  1. Waiʻanae High School is a public, coeducational secondary school in the City and County of Honolulu, Hawaii, United States, on the leeward (western) coast of the island of Oʻahu. The school about 40 miles (64 km) northwest of central Honolulu CDP.

  3. The school has an academy structure to focus on student interests and needs, personalizing education and increasing rigor and relevance. Academies are also focused on building parent communication and involvement, and the systemic use of data to drive and monitor improvement efforts.

  5. Waianae High School is a public high school in Waianae, Hawaii, serving 1,831 students in grades 9-12. The school is part of the Hawaii Department of Education district, which is ranked 1 out of 1 in the state and rated 5 stars out of 5 by SchoolDigger.

  6. Wai‘anae High built a comprehensive system of academic and behavioral supports, including adopting some good ideas from Kapa‘a High: the Transitions to High School Curriculum for its new 9th Grade Success Academy and peer-to-peer mentoring.
